"Everybody" says blackjack.  But to get those good edges, which in most of the 8-deck games aren't so good as advertised, you have to do a lot of doubles and splits.  Not to much mention also the requirement to heavily spread your bets... even if the casinos much allow that either.  (I've always advocated to blend it in with progressive betting, if you really know what you're doing, and have at least five years of steady play under your belt.)

Baccarat's utilitarian HE can quickly be brought under the 0.5% (, comparable to the best casino-blackjack games in the "public" rooms out front), again if you know what you're doing.  Beating it is a different story but likely easier than playing expert roulette (, though fewer persons would believe you.  There's a lot more room for the "inventing" of those useless roulette- gizmos, bells-and-whistles.)
